Mexican Chili Soup

Mexican Chili Soup brings together tender cubes of beef, pinto beans, and a bold blend of chili powder, cumin, and cayenne simmered in beef stock with enchilada sauce and tomato paste for layered depth. It’s hearty and warming with gentle heat and a rich, savory finish—perfect ladled over rice and finished with cheese, sour cream, and crunchy tortilla chips for a cozy dinner.

Mexican Chili Soup
  1. 1

    Heat oil in a large pot over high heat. Sauté the meat until browned on all sides, about 5 minutes. Add the onions and garlic. Keep sautéing until the onions are soft, 4 to 5 minutes.

  2. 2

    Add the chili powder, cumin, coriander, cayenne pepper, and bay leaves to the pot. Cook and stir until the meat and vegetables are coated with the seasonings, about 2 minutes. Add the stock, enchilada sauce, green chile peppers, and tomato paste. Bring to a boil. Lower the heat to low, cover the pot, and simmer until the meat is tender, about 50 minutes.

  3. 3

    Stir the beans into the soup, mashing some beans to thicken if desired. Simmer until heated through, about 5 minutes.
